FRW Character Creator, v.2.0.0
by ladydesire ([email protected])
Updated: 22 January 2008
---Purpose:
This module is designed to help players create balanced characters for use in other community-made modules. It will level your characters and give them an appropriate amount of gold for their new level. It will also permit you to purchase a limited assortment of items so that you can have a basic equipment foundation to take with you into new modules. The emphasis is on creating balanced, not overpowered characters that adhere to the classic D&D equipment magic standards endorsed by the Forgotten Realms Weave (FRW) group. It can also serve as a waystation for characters between modules, allowing you to sell off loot, empty your inventory of unwanted items, and buy new gear/potions.
Finally, it serves as a showcase for FRW modules, allowing users to meet NPC's from these modules, learn about the module offerings available, and purchase some of the custom items from these modules.
---Features:
* Level up your character & receive an appropriate amount of gold for this new level.
* Equip your character with a basic foundation of gear that is appropriate for your level. For low-level characters, these include silver & cold iron masterwork items.
* Meet with NPC's from FRW modules and learn about those modules.
* Access the Bartender's Store, which contains (at a premium price) custom items from FRW modules.
* Sell off loot from previous modules, ditch unwanted items, and re-equip your character between adventures.
* Remove no-drop items from your inventory.
* Do a limited amount of crafting (no magic station).
* Adjust your alignment.
New in this release:
Support for the FRW Persistent Companion System (requires hak file).
Leveling up to Level 30 to support MotB and future Epic Level modules.
1/15: I will be posting an updated version of the FRW Character Creator that supports the Epic Levels currently available in Mask of the Betrayer within the week; I will also be adding support for the FRW Persistant Companion System, including an area that you can use to acquire some available Persistant Companions. Thank you for your patience and your continued interest in this project.
1/22: In addition to the new features mentioned above, I have added a way for a level one character to gain a small amount of gold; simply speak with Chatter as you normally would to level up and select the Level 1 option.
2/15: added the FRW Persistant Companion hak do the list of downloads to ease locating that file.
